Symbolism and Sentimentality:

Beyond their aesthetic appeal, both watches and rings carry profound symbolism and sentimentality. A watch is often regarded as a symbol of punctuality, professionalism, and timelessness. It represents not only the passage of time but also the milestones and moments we cherish. Whether it's a heirloom timepiece passed down through generations or a luxury watch acquired to mark a significant achievement, watches hold sentimental value and become treasured keepsakes.


Similarly, rings are imbued with rich symbolism, representing love, commitment, and connection. Engagement rings symbolize the promise of a lifelong partnership, while wedding bands serve as enduring symbols of unity and devotion. Beyond romantic relationships, rings can also hold personal significance, commemorating milestones, accomplishments, or meaningful connections. Each ring tells a story, carrying the memories and emotions of those who wear them.


Functionality and Practicality:

In terms of functionality and practicality, watches and rings serve different purposes. A watch, as a timekeeping device, offers convenience and utility, allowing wearers to track time with ease and precision. Whether you're scheduling meetings, timing workouts, or simply staying punctual, a watch is an essential accessory that enhances productivity and efficiency in daily life.


On the other hand, while rings may not serve a practical function in the same way as watches, they offer their own unique benefits. Rings can elevate an outfit, add a touch of glamour, and spark conversations. They can also convey social status, cultural identity, and personal style. While not essential for day-to-day activities, rings enhance our sense of self and contribute to our overall aesthetic expression.
